Key Responsibilities
As an Senior Specialist – Transportation Management you will be responsible to plan, implement, coordinate, steer and optimise inbound logistics, transportation and empty container processes for the Power Co facility in St. Thomas. Reporting to the Inbound Logistics Manager you will support and contribute to the Power Co Logistics team to achieve the objectives of the logistics rollout project of Power Co Canada.
This is a flex hybrid work structure, where employees can work both remotely and on‑site at our St. Thomas location.
What You Bring To The Team
- Develop a robust, resilient, and cost‑efficient transportation network for Power Co Canada including the flow of empty container, covering road, rail, intermodal, ocean, air, and parcel logistics.
- Adapt and implement all inbound logistics processes locally based on Power Co headquarters standards, including defining IT requirements, packaging concepts, and cross‑functional interfaces.
- Plan, establish, and operate the Truck Control Center, including processes for arrival management, slot control, yard management, access control, safety requirements, and digital workflow integration.
- End‑to‑end responsibility for empty container management, including process definition (planning & standards), implementation and system setup and operational control including monitoring and capacity management.
- Technically evaluate and technically discuss with transportation service providers (carriers, shortline railroads, 3PLs, 4PLs), including RFP/RFQ preparation, offer evaluation, and contract compliance monitoring.
- Plan logistics‑related site infrastructure (road and rail) and define requirements for connections to public or third‑party infrastructure.
- Manage and report transport performance, including KPI setup, monthly reporting, transport demand forecasting, long‑term capacity planning, and short‑term mitigation of capacity shortages.
- Collaborate closely with internal and external stakeholders (Power Co Canada, Volkswagen Canada, Power Co HQ) and drive continuous process improvements, prepare management presentations, and execute all logistics rollout‑related activities.
